Seven to 10 days after surgery. That is when I clear most of my fly-in patients to board a plane home after a deep plane facelift, and not one day before I have examined the face and the legs in person. The drains come out at 48 to 72 hours. The sutures come out around day 7. Somewhere between that suture visit and day 10, if the face is quiet and the body shows no sign of trouble, I say the words patients have been waiting for: you can go home.
The reason for that number is not caution for its own sake. It is a collision of two calendars. The days when a fly-in patient most wants to travel, days 5 through 14, sit squarely inside the window when the body is most prone to forming a blood clot after surgery. A patient who books a return flight for day 3 has, without knowing it, scheduled their trip for the most dangerous stretch of their entire recovery. My job is to make sure that never happens, and this article is my full explanation of why, because I have found that patients follow rules they understand and quietly bend rules they do not.

The clot window is the whole story
Everything about the timing of your flight home comes down to venous thromboembolism, the formation of a blood clot in a deep vein that can break loose and travel to the lungs. Surgeons shorten it to VTE, and it is the complication we respect most in the travel conversation, because it is the one that can turn serious at 35,000 feet with no warning and no help nearby.
Surgery itself tilts the body toward clotting. The trauma of an operation activates the clotting cascade, anesthesia and recovery keep you stiller than normal life does, and healing tissue releases signals that thicken the blood’s response for weeks. This is not unique to facelifts, and it is not a flaw in any surgeon’s technique. It is physiology. A large prospective study of nearly a million middle-aged women in the United Kingdom found that the risk of being admitted with a clot was dramatically elevated in the first 6 weeks after an inpatient operation and remained measurably raised through 12 weeks. Even day case surgery carried a real, elevated risk across that same stretch.
Now add the airplane. A meta-analysis in the Annals of Internal Medicine pooled 14 studies and found that travel roughly doubled the risk of VTE overall, and when the analysis corrected for a known bias in some studies, the risk was closer to threefold. More useful still, the effect followed a dose response: roughly 18 percent higher risk for every additional 2 hours of travel by any mode, and about 26 percent higher for every 2 hours specifically in the air. The CDC’s Yellow Book, the reference American travel medicine works from, flags journeys longer than about 4 hours as the threshold where this risk becomes meaningful, and lists recent surgery among the factors that raise it further.
So the arithmetic a fly-in patient faces is simple and unforgiving. Fresh surgery raises clot risk. Long flights raise clot risk. Doing both in the same week multiplies two risks that were each acceptable alone. The solution is not fear. The solution is sequencing: let the steepest days of surgical clot risk pass on the ground, near me, walking a little more each day, and only then add the airplane.
There is a detail here that patients find clarifying. The complication I watch for in the first 24 hours is different. A hematoma, a collection of blood under the skin flaps, is the most common complication after a facelift, and the majority declare themselves within the first day, which is exactly why my patients spend those first nights in a supervised recovery suite rather than a hotel room alone. By day 7, the hematoma question is largely settled. The clot question is not. That asymmetry is why the early days are about being near me, and the travel decision is about the calendar.
What the cabin actually does to a healing face
Patients worry about the wrong thing here, so let me sort it honestly. The dramatic fear, that cabin pressure will “pop” something or tear a suture line, is unfounded. Nothing about a pressurized cabin threatens a well-executed deep plane repair. The real effects are humbler, and they are about swelling and about clots, not about the surgery coming apart.
A commercial aircraft is pressurized not to sea level but to the equivalent of roughly 6,000 to 8,000 feet of altitude, about the same as sitting on a mountainside in Lake Tahoe. At that pressure, gas in the body expands slightly and the partial pressure of oxygen falls, which is trivial for a healthy traveler and mostly still trivial for a healing one. But a face that is 1 or 2 weeks out from surgery is a landscape of fluid in motion. Lymphatic channels are interrupted and slowly reconnecting. Tissue is holding extra water. Put that face in a low-pressure, low-humidity cabin, keep the body seated and dependent for hours, add the salty food and the dehydration of travel, and the face you land with will often be puffier than the face that boarded. Cabin humidity commonly runs far below what any indoor room provides, which thickens the blood slightly and dries the healing skin.
Here is the honest frame I give patients: after I have cleared you, cabin swelling is a comfort problem, not a safety problem. You may land in Sacramento looking a day or two “behind” where you were that morning, and within 48 hours of elevation, hydration, and normal walking, the face returns to its trajectory. Individual results vary, and I tell every patient to expect the mirror to be moody for weeks regardless of whether they fly. What the cabin cannot do, once the timing is right, is undo the operation. What it can do, if the timing is wrong, is contribute to the clot scenario I described above. That is why the clearance exam matters more than any general rule you read online, including this one.
My timeline, day by day
Every recovery is its own weather, and I adjust for age, clot history, medications, and how the tissues are behaving. But after thousands of facelifts, the shape of the safe path home is consistent enough to draw. This is the calendar I build for a fly-in patient, and it is why I ask U.S. patients to plan a minimum of about 6 days in Tijuana before any travel at all.
- DAY 0Surgery, then a supervised night. The operation is done under general anesthesia with my board-certified anesthesiologist, and you sleep your first night in the recovery suite with nursing, not in a hotel. The first 24 hours are when a hematoma would declare itself, so this is the night I refuse to outsource.
- 48 TO 72 HRSDrains out. I remove the drains myself once output falls. You are walking short, frequent laps by now, which is your single best clot prevention, and you are seen daily.
- DAY 4 TO 6The quiet middle. Swelling peaks and begins to turn. You rest, walk, hydrate, and I watch for the things patients cannot see in a mirror: asymmetric tension, skin color changes, a calf that feels different from its twin.
- DAY 7Sutures out, decision visit. I remove sutures and examine you head to toe with travel in mind. This is the visit where flying home becomes a plan instead of a wish. Many California patients are cleared to be driven across the border around this point.
- DAY 7 TO 10Cleared for a short flight. If the exam is clean, I clear direct flights in the 1 to 3 hour range, with aisle seat, walking, and hydration instructions. This covers most of the western United States from San Diego.
- DAY 10 TO 14Longer domestic flights. Cross-country travel earns clearance a few days later, because the dose response is real: more hours in the seat means more risk, so I ask the calendar for more healing first.
- WEEK 2 TO 6Long haul, with respect. International flights and anything over 6 hours are the last to be cleared, sometimes toward the later end of this window, because postoperative clot risk stays measurably elevated for weeks. Compression, movement, and sometimes a hematology conversation come first.
Notice what this timeline is not. It is not a promise that day 8 is safe for everyone, and it is not a punishment for the impatient. It is a ladder where each rung is earned by an exam, not by a date on a boarding pass. Individual results vary, and I have held patients past day 10 for reasons as small as a calf that felt warm to my hand. Every one of them thanked me later, some through gritted teeth at the time.

A 90 minute flight is not a 6 hour flight
The dose response in the travel literature deserves its own moment, because it changes decisions in a practical way. If every 2 hours in the air raises clot risk by roughly a quarter again, then the difference between San Diego to Sacramento and San Diego to New York is not a detail. It is several increments of stacked risk, taken by a body that is already primed to clot.
This is why I refuse to give one universal flight answer, and why the geography of my practice matters more than patients first realize. A patient from Los Angeles or Orange County often does not fly at all. They are driven across the border and up the interstate, free to stop in San Clemente, walk 5 minutes, and continue. A patient from the Bay Area takes one short direct flight. A patient from Chicago or Miami is planning a genuinely different medical event, and I schedule their stay and their clearance accordingly, sometimes adding days in Tijuana or a buffer weekend in San Diego on the far side of the border before the long leg home.
There is also a quieter argument for the short first leg, one I learned from years of doing this rather than from a journal. A patient who lands after 90 minutes is tired. A patient who lands after 6 hours, two time zones, and a layover is depleted, dehydrated, and swollen, and depletion is the enemy of every healing tissue. When patients ask me whether they should book the cheaper itinerary with the connection or the direct flight, my answer is always the direct flight, and not for comfort. Every additional hour of travel is an hour of sitting, and every layover tempts a tired patient to slump motionless in a terminal chair instead of walking.
One more distinction I want on the record, because a patient asked me once with real fear in her voice: the risk we are managing rides with the hours and the immobility, not with the airplane itself. A 6 hour car ride taken without stops is not automatically safer than a 2 hour flight. The car simply gives you the power to stop every hour, stand, and walk, and I expect my driving patients to actually use it.
What I check before I say yes
The clearance visit around day 7 is short, but nothing about it is casual. Patients sometimes assume I am only admiring the incisions. The incisions are the least of it.
I look at the face for the ordinary story of a good recovery: swelling that is symmetric and receding, skin that is warm and well perfused over the flaps, no collection forming under the surface, incision lines closed and calm. I ask about pain, because pain that is escalating at day 7 is moving in the wrong direction and deserves an explanation before an airport does. Then I leave the face entirely. I look at the legs, ask about calf tenderness or one leg swelling more than the other, and I ask blunt systemic questions: any shortness of breath, any chest discomfort, any fever, any lightheadedness on standing. None of these belong to a normal facelift recovery, and any one of them cancels a flight until it is explained.
I also rehearse the trip itself with the patient, seat selection, walking schedule, water, medication timing, who meets them at the far end. It takes 5 minutes and it converts a vague intention to “take it easy” into a plan someone can actually follow at gate 34 with a boarding group being called. How to fly, once you are cleared
Clearance is not the end of my instructions, it is the beginning of the practical ones. The travel medicine literature is refreshingly concrete about what actually lowers clot risk in a seat, and almost all of it costs nothing.
Movement is first, and it is not optional. I ask patients to book an aisle seat specifically so that standing costs them no social negotiation, and to walk the cabin for a few minutes every hour the seatbelt sign allows. Between walks, the calves do the work: ankle circles, heel raises, pressing the feet into the floor, a quiet minute of pumping every half hour. The calf muscles are the venous return pump of the lower body, and a working pump is the cheapest thrombosis prevention that exists. The CDC’s guidance for travelers at elevated risk adds properly fitted graduated compression stockings, and I agree; I have patients fitted before the trip rather than grabbing an airport pair, because a stocking that rolls into a tight band behind the knee is worse than none. What I do not want is improvised pharmacology. Do not add aspirin or any blood thinner for the flight on your own; after fresh surgery, that trade of bleeding risk for clot risk is a medical decision, mine and sometimes a hematologist’s, never a gift shop decision.
Then hydration, which sounds trivial until you remember the cabin is drier than any room you live in. Water through the whole flight, and no alcohol, both because it dehydrates and because it tempts a healing patient into hours of motionless sleep. On that note, skip the sedatives and sleeping pills too. A patient who is unconscious for 5 hours in a window seat has recreated, in miniature, the exact immobility we spent a week avoiding.
For the face itself, my requests are modest. Keep the head elevated, which an upright seat does for you. Do not press a cold pack against cheeks that are still partially numb; skin that cannot feel cannot warn you, and that is how frostbite happens to well-meaning people. Expect your ears to feel odd with pressure changes if swelling reaches near them, and expect to land a little puffier than you took off, which we have already agreed is a comfort issue by this stage. Carry your operative note and my contact information in your hand luggage, not your checked bag, along with your medications and a scarf if attention bothers you. Someone meets you at the far end and drives; you do not land at 9 at night and slide behind a wheel. None of this is complicated. It is simply a plan, and a patient with a plan travels better than a patient with hope.
The signs that ground you, even at the gate
Let me say the uncomfortable part plainly, because I would rather lose a patient a rebooking fee than lose a patient. If, on the morning of your flight, you notice new one-sided facial swelling, a calf that aches or has grown, a fever, chest pain, or breathlessness, you do not board. Not with a scarf, not with an extra pain pill, not with the reasoning that you will “get checked at home.” A pulmonary embolism does not negotiate with itinerary logic, and an expanding collection in the face is easiest to treat early and near the surgeon who knows the anatomy of your operation.
The protocol is simple. You call me first if there is time to call anyone, and my patients can reach me directly, but chest pain or real shortness of breath means emergency services immediately, in whichever country you are standing in. Everything else, one-sided swelling, calf symptoms, fever, gets same-day eyes on it, mine if you are still in Tijuana or San Diego, an emergency department’s if you are not. Every patient of mine travels with a complete operative note in English so that no physician who receives them is working blind. I will also tell you what these signs are not, because fear inflates in a hotel room. Swelling that is generous but symmetric is normal. Bruising that drains down the neck and chest in lurid colors is normal. Tightness around the ears, numbness of the cheeks, a lumpy feeling along the jawline, all normal, all temporary for the great majority of patients. Individual results vary, but the red flags above are specific for a reason: they are one-sided, they are systemic, or they involve the chest and the breath. Everything else is usually recovery being recovery.
When flying in to see me is the wrong plan
I spend most of this site explaining who I can help. Honesty requires the other list too, and the travel question sharpens it.
If you have a personal history of deep vein thrombosis or pulmonary embolism, a known clotting disorder, or you are on chronic anticoagulation, I am not going to tell you that a facelift trip is impossible, but I am going to tell you it needs a hematologist’s input before it needs an itinerary, and there are cases I will decline. If your only route home is a very long haul, if you cannot arrange the roughly 6 day minimum stay near my facility, or if your plan involves flying out on day 3 because of work, then the correct decision is not to squeeze my protocol, it is either to change the plan or to have surgery closer to home. A facelift done near your house with a rushed surgeon is a bad idea; a facelift done far from your house with a rushed timeline is a worse one. The same goes for anyone whose medical picture makes general anesthesia or a 2 week recovery unreasonable; the flight is simply the last item on a list of reasons to wait.
